King County residents received their annual valentine from the county assessor’s office as property tax bills for 2013 were sent out on Feb. 14.
Property taxes are mixed in King County for 2013, with property values and property taxes down for many, according to assessor Lloyd Hara. However, some property owners will see their property values decline while their property taxes increase, and other property owners will see both their property values increase and property taxes increase.

King County Assessor Lloyd Hara and his colleagues from his office, the King County Tax Advisor’s Office and the Treasurer’s Office held a meeting March 14 at the Burien Library/City Hall Building. Only about nine citizens attended. Hara said he has hosted nearly 400 such meetings in the last few years.
